ZNNU 0 Опубликовано: 2007-12-03 22:15:22 Share Опубликовано: 2007-12-03 22:15:22 Возникла идея впихнутьв крон скриптик, который будет проверять количество денег на балансе у всех пользователей, и если значение баласнса будет меньше определенной суммы отправлять через консольный конфигуратор сообщение пользователю. Кто-то реализовывал подобное? Ссылка на сообщение Поделиться на других сайтах
madf 279 Опубліковано: 2007-12-04 10:28:26 Share Опубліковано: 2007-12-04 10:28:26 В последнем авторизаторе есть опция: его иконка в трее начинает мигать когда на счету остается меньше N денег. N - настраивается. Ссылка на сообщение Поделиться на других сайтах
Колян 2 Опубліковано: 2007-12-04 12:04:15 Share Опубліковано: 2007-12-04 12:04:15 Скрипт написать не проблема, если кто знает пхп, пишите, могу скинуть пару функций для работы с стг, отправка сообщений, добавление денег, и т.д. Ссылка на сообщение Поделиться на других сайтах
napTu 4 Опубліковано: 2007-12-05 09:23:23 Share Опубліковано: 2007-12-05 09:23:23 Я завернул веб трафик на локальный http при отключенном авторизаторе или при отсутствии денег на счету. Ссылка на сообщение Поделиться на других сайтах
ZNNU 0 Опубліковано: 2007-12-05 19:07:37 Автор Share Опубліковано: 2007-12-05 19:07:37 Зачем на http? Юзер и в авторизаторе видит, что у него денег не осталось. Идея была написать скрипт, который будет прописан в кронтабе и уведомлять пользователей сообщением через консольный конфигуратор, когда на счету осталось меньше 2-х (например) денег. Аля предупредительная смс мобильных операторов. Ссылка на сообщение Поделиться на других сайтах
napTu 4 Опубліковано: 2007-12-05 19:14:51 Share Опубліковано: 2007-12-05 19:14:51 я понял, просто подкидываю идею - удобно увидеть что у тебя не запущен авторизатор или закончились деньги при попытке загрузить страницу инета. а по теме - последние авторизаторы сами могут моргать при мало денег. да и скрипт тот не проблема: раз в сутки (или при ONConnect что еще проще) листаем пользователей, ls -lf /usr/stg/var/users/ | grep drw | awk '{print $9}' > /usr/stg/userlist отгребаем денежные тарифы фильтруем по деньгам for line in $(cat "/usr/stg/userlist") do ip=`cat /usr/stg/var/users/$line/conf | grep IP=` trf=`cat /usr/stg/var/users/$line/conf | grep Tariff=` adr=`cat /usr/stg/var/users/$line/conf | grep Address=` adr=`echo $adr | cut -d '=' -f2|cut -d ' ' -f1` trf=`echo $trf | cut -d '=' -f2` ipa=`echo $ip | cut -d '=' -f2` ipa2=`echo ",$ipa," | cut -d ',' -f3` ipa=`echo $ipa | cut -d ',' -f1` aipa3=`echo $ipa | cut -d '.' -f3` aipa4=`echo $ipa | cut -d '.' -f4` aipa=$aipa3$aipa4 .... через sgconf шлём мессагу Ссылка на сообщение Поделиться на других сайтах
vop 370 Опубліковано: 2007-12-05 21:04:15 Share Опубліковано: 2007-12-05 21:04:15 Идея была написать скрипт, который будет прописан в кронтабе и уведомлять пользователей сообщением через консольный конфигуратор, когда на счету осталось меньше 2-х (например) денег. Аля предупредительная смс мобильных операторов. Когда-то ообсуждали разделение функционала между компонентами, и пришли к выводу, что все сообщения-предупреждения (т.е. сторожевые фенкции) - это исключительно внутренний функционал авторизатора. Клиент сам должен иметь возможность устаналвливать разные критерии, лимит денег, лимит трафика и т.д. И нефиг для этого грузить сервер. Ссылка на сообщение Поделиться на других сайтах
Рекомендованные сообщения
Создайте аккаунт или войдите в него для комментирования
Вы должны быть пользователем, чтобы оставить комментарий
Создать аккаунт
Зарегистрируйтесь для получения аккаунта. Это просто!
Зарегистрировать аккаунтВхід
Уже зарегистрированы? Войдите здесь.
Войти сейчас